1. Low Carb Lemon Bars

These lemon bars are tangy, sweet, and refreshing.

Ingredients

Crust

  • 1 cup almond flour

  • 3 tbsp butter

  • 2 tbsp sweetener

Filling

  • 2 eggs

  • ¼ cup lemon juice

  • 3 tbsp sweetener

  • 1 tsp lemon zest

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

  2. Mix crust ingredients and press into baking dish.

  3. Bake for 10 minutes.

  4. Mix filling ingredients and pour over crust.

  5. Bake for 15 minutes.


2. Low Carb Peanut Butter Cups

These homemade peanut butter cups are creamy and chocolatey.

Ingredients

  • ½ cup sugar-free chocolate

  • ¼ cup peanut butter

  • 1 tbsp coconut oil

  • 1 tbsp sweetener

Instructions

  1. Melt chocolate and coconut oil.

  2. Pour a thin layer into silicone molds.

  3. Add peanut butter mixture.

  4. Cover with remaining chocolate.

  5. Freeze for 30 minutes.


3. Low Carb Strawberry Cream Dessert

A light and refreshing dessert.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ream

  • ½ cup sliced strawberries

  • 2 tbsp sweetener

  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Whip cream until fluffy.

  2. Mix in sweetener and vanilla.

  3. Fold in strawberries.

  4. Chill before serving.


4. Low Carb Coconut Macaroons

These chewy coconut treats are easy to make.

Ingredients

  • 1½ cups shredded coconut

  • 2 egg whites

  • 3 tbsp sweetener

  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 325°F (160°C).

  2. Mix ingredients together.

  3. Scoop onto baking sheet.

  4. Bake for 15 minutes.


5. Low Carb Chocolate Avocado Mousse

A creamy chocolate dessert packed with healthy fats.

Ingredients

  • 1 ripe avocado

  • 2 tbsp cocoa powder

  • 3 tbsp sweetener

  • ¼ cup almond milk

  • 1 tsp vanilla

Instructions

Blend all ingredients until smooth and chill before serving.


6. Low Carb Almond Butter Cookies

These cookies are soft and nutty.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up almond butter

  • ¼ cup sweetener

  • 1 egg

  • ½ tsp baking soda

Instructions

  1. Mix ingredients.

  2. Form small cookie balls.

  3. Bake 10–12 minutes at 350°F.

8. Low Carb Chocolate Bark

Perfect for chocolate lovers.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up sugar-free chocolate chips

  • ¼ cup almonds

  • 2 tbsp shredded coconut

Instructions

  1. Melt chocolate.

  2. Spread on parchment paper.

  3. Sprinkle nuts and coconut.

  4. Refrigerate until firm.


9. Low Carb Vanilla Chia Pudding

A healthy dessert with fiber and healthy fats.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up almond milk

  • 3 tbsp chia seeds

  • 2 tbsp sweetener

  • 1 tsp vanilla

Instructions

Mix ingredients and refrigerate for 2 hours.


10. Low Carb Cream Cheese Truffles

These truffles are rich and creamy.

Ingredients

  • 8 oz cream cheese

  • 3 tbsp sweetener

  • ½ cup almond flour

  • cocoa powder (for coating)

Instructions

  1. Mix cream cheese, sweetener, and almond flour.

  2. Form small balls.

  3. Roll in cocoa powder.

  4. Refrigerate for 1 hour.
